Skip to content

Latest commit

 

History

History
64 lines (48 loc) · 1.12 KB

Readme.md

File metadata and controls

64 lines (48 loc) · 1.12 KB

FitApp

FitApp é uma API em desenvolvimento com .NET 8 e Entity Framework Core que gerencia exercícios físicos de usuários.

Autores

Tecnologias Utilizadas

  • .NET 8
  • Entity Framework Core
  • SQL Server
  • JWT (JSON Web Tokens) para autenticação

Requisitos

  • .NET 8 SDK
  • SQL Server
  • Visual Studio ou Visual Studio Code

Configuração do Projeto

Clonar o Repositório

git clone https://github.com/leonardopaeslp/FitApp.git
cd WebApiExercicio

Configurar a String de Conexão

{
  "ConnectionStrings": {
    "DefaultConnection": "Server=your_server;Database=your_database;User Id=your_user;Password=your_password;"
  },
  "Jwt": {
    "Key": "your_secret_key",
    "Issuer": "your_issuer",
    "Audience": "your_audience"
  },
  "Logging": {
    "LogLevel": {
      "Default": "Information",
      "Microsoft.AspNetCore": "Warning"
    }
  },
  "AllowedHosts": "*"
}

Executar Migrações e Atualizar o Banco de Dados

dotnet ef migrations add InitialCreate
dotnet ef database update

Executar o Projeto

dotnet run